JKNC and BJP secured 2 seats each, IND candidate Abdul Rashid clinched Baramulla in J&K

J&K Lok Sabha election result 2024: Rajouri, Baramulla, Jammu, Srinagar, and Udhampur seats for Jammu and Kashmir.

In Jammu and Kashmir, the police have implemented an extensive three-tier security arrangement at a counting centre in Kathua district in anticipation of the vote counting for the Udhampur seat. This region sends five representatives to the Lok Sabha, the lower house of Parliament.

The seats are Rajouri, Baramulla, Jammu, Srinagar, and Udhampur.

The Senior Superintendent of Police (SSP) Anayat, stationed at Kathua, provided told ANI, “We rehearsed; this will also help with field familiarisation of the forces that have come from outside. We have made a three-tier security deployment.”

SSP Anayat emphasized the readiness of the police force, highlighting the collaborative efforts with the district administration. “Police, with the help of district administration, are almost ready for June 4, the poll counting day. We are very hopeful that a very peaceful counting session will be held,” he stated.

On 4th June, stringent security checks will be enforced, with a particular focus on monitoring vehicles for any miscreants. The police have also urged the public to engage with in-charge police officers in the event of any disputes or confrontations, rather than taking matters into their own hands. “My only request with the people is to maintain coordination with the security forces. If there is any dispute or confrontation with the police, you can speak with the in-charge police officers,” SSP Anayat added.

“Do not take the law into your hands.”

SSP Anayat noted that elections in the region are celebrated with a festive spirit, and people are encouraged to come out and express their support for their candidates. He reassured the public that there would be no route diversions on the counting day. “Traffic will flow on both sides. Vehicles would be checked up,” he said.

Lok Sabha ConstituencyElected CandidateElected Party
RajouriMIAN ALTAF AHMADJKNC
BaramullaABDUL RASHID SHEIKHIndependent
JammuJUGAL KISHOREBJP
SrinagarAGA SYED RUHULLAH MEHDIJKNC
UdhampurDR JITENDRA SINGHBJP

Omar Abdullah congratulates Abdul Rashid

Omar Abdullah, the National Conference (NC) vice president and former Chief Minister of Jammu and Kashmir, has conceded defeat to independent candidate Abdul Rashid Sheikh in the Baramulla Lok Sabha constituency. In a post shared on his X account, Abdullah expressed his acceptance of the outcome, stating, "I think it’s time to accept the inevitable. Congratulations to Engineer Rashid for his victory in North Kashmir. I don’t believe his victory will hasten his release from prison nor will the people of North Kashmir get the representation they have a right to but the voters have spoken and in a democracy that’s all that matters."

Who is Mian Altaf Ahmad? Independent candidate leading in Rajouri

Mian Altaf Ahmad, a Gujjar cleric and a leader of the National Conference (NC), hails from a family that has been the caretaker of a revered shrine in central Kashmir’s Kangan area. The shrine holds immense religious significance for the Gujjar community, attracting thousands of devotees from across Jammu and Kashmir during its annual ‘urs’ celebrations.

BJP remains in lead in Jammu and Udhampur

According to the latest Election Commission trends, the Bharatiya Janata Party (BJP) is leading ahead of the Indian National Congress (INC) in the Jammu and Udhampur Lok Sabha seats in Jammu and Kashmir. In Udhampur, Union Minister Jitendra Singh is leading by21,569 votes, while in Jammu, sitting MP Jugal Kishore Sharma is ahead by 57,231 votes.
